Hvad er RegEx i SQL?
Hvad er RegEx i SQL?

Video: Hvad er RegEx i SQL?

Video: Hvad er RegEx i SQL?
Video: Entity Relationship Diagram (ERD) Tutorial - Part 1 2024, November
Anonim

EN almindelig udtryk er simpelthen en sekvens af tegn eller et mønster. SQL databaser indeholder forskellige typer data såsom strenge, numeriske, billeder samt andre ustrukturerede data. Forespørgsler ind SQL ofte behov for at returnere data baseret på regulære udtryk . Denne lektion beskriver, hvordan dette kan gøres.

Angående dette, kan jeg bruge RegEx i SQL?

I modsætning til MySQL og Oracle, SQL Server database gør understøtter ikke indbygget RegEx funktioner. Imidlertid, SQL Server tilbyder indbyggede funktioner til at tackle så komplekse problemer. Eksempler på sådanne funktioner er LIKE, PATINDEX, CHARINDEX, SUBSTRING og REPLACE.

Udover ovenstående, HVAD ER A i RegEx? Hver karakter i en almindelig udtryk (det vil sige, at hvert tegn i strengen, der beskriver dets mønster) er enten et metategn, der har en særlig betydning, eller et regulært tegn, der har en bogstavelig betydning. For eksempel i regex en., a er et bogstaveligt tegn, som kun matcher 'a', mens '.

Udover ovenstående, hvad er udtryk i SQL?

An udtryk er en kombination af en eller flere værdier, operatorer og SQL funktioner, der evalueres til en værdi. Disse SQL UDTRYK er som formler, og de er skrevet i forespørgselssprog. Du kan også bruge dem til at forespørge databasen om et bestemt sæt data.

Hvordan indeholder brugen i SQL?

INDEHOLDER er et prædikat brugt i WHERE-klausulen i en Transakt- SQL SELECT-sætning, der skal udføres SQL Server fuldtekstsøgning på fuldtekstindekserede kolonner indeholdende tegnbaserede datatyper. INDEHOLDER kan søge efter: Et ord eller en sætning. Præfikset for et ord eller en sætning.

Anbefalede: